Output 101c80211540ebc600a5ef61f13369bd4a50e26138a3fd665b4cda522d161d5a:16

value
538468128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f45947a7bc2226980dfedd11213d1317c0d02dd OP_EQUAL
address
MNRK2S86ER9Cv3Q5oJ7YVf1yZBLSN8XuCy
transaction
101c80211540ebc600a5ef61f13369bd4a50e26138a3fd665b4cda522d161d5a
spent
true